12. Gently detach the upper case from the lower case. Removing the Touchpad Board Module 1. See "Removing the Battery Pack" on page 51. 2. See "Removing the Lower Cover" on page 51. 3. See "Removing the Lower Cover" on page 51. 4. See "Removing the Fan Module" on page 59. 5. See "Removing the CPU Heatsink Module" on page 60. 6. See "Removing the CPU" on page 61. 7. See "Removing the Middle Cover" on page 62. 8. See "Removing the Keyboard" on page 63. 9. See "Removing the LCD Module" on page 64. 10. See "Separating the Upper Case from the Lower Case" on page 68. 11. Disconnect the touchpad cable from the touchpad board. 12. Remove the two screws (C) on the touchpad bracket. Step 1~4 Chapter 3 Size (Quantity) M2 x L3 (4) Color Silver Torque 1.6 kgf-cm 69
